

UG Programme in Psychology and Marketing at Masters' Union Overview
Masters' Union offers a 4 years UG Programme in Psychology and Marketing course at the UG level. To get admitted to this course, applicants must meet the entry requirements and must have a valid CBSE 12th score. The total tuition fee for this course is INR 43,68,000 for the entire duration. The salary trends witnessed during Masters' Union placements for PGP TBM programme over the past three years with respect to the highest, average and median package are presented below:
Particulars | PGP TBM Placement Statistics (2022) | PGP TBM Placement Statistics (2023) | PGP TBM Placement Statistics (2024) |
|---|---|---|---|
the highest package | INR 64.15 LPA | INR 57.08 LPA | INR 61.8 LPA |
Average package | INR 33.1 LPA | INR 34.07 LPA | INR 28.52 LPA |
Top 25% average package | INR 44.52 LPA | INR 44.67 LPA | INR 43.79 LPA |
Below 25% average package | INR 20.02 LPA | INR 22.35 LPA | INR 19.3 LPA |
Middle 80% average package | INR 33.73 LPA | INR 34.09 LPA | INR 27.05 LPA |
Median package | INR 30.92 LPA | INR 32.18 LPA | INR 27.66 LPA |
Masters Union does not have a minimum GPA requirement as the GPA system is not a global grading methodology. The college focuses on the courses students have taken, grades received and overall academic performance.

The role-wise average package offered and offers distribution made during PGP TBM placements 2024 are presented below:
Roles | Average Package (2024) | Offers Distribution (2024) |
|---|---|---|
Founder’s Office & Chief of Staff | INR 26.12 LPA | 11.2% |
Business & Strategy | INR 27.54 LPA | 30.1% |
Product Management | INR 32.41 LPA | 15.4% |
Marketing | INR 23.25 LPA | 7% |
Finance | INR 33.44 LPA | 5.6% |
Sales | INR 27.17 LPA | 11.9% |
Data | INR 33.12 LPA | 16.1% |
Operations | INR 25.07 LPA | 2.8% |

Admission for undergraduate programme involves the academic scores of 12th grade from recognised board. Additionally, students must also appear for Masters' Union Business Aptitude Test (MUSAT), followed by a video-based response and personal interview (PI) round. For PGP, all the above with CAT/GMAT/GRE scores are also accepted.
The final grades for most courses will be determined by a mix of class participation, quizzes, simulations, group assignments, projects and exams. Masters' Union grades the exams on a Standard Normal Curve, also called a Z-curve, with a mean of 3.0. There are no forced-to-fails. To graduate, students must maintain a mean grade of 2.1 in both the core and electives courses.

Hello Nishar Ahmed, no student cannot join the Masters' Union directly. I will explain in short subsequently how the admission process takes place.
Every student first has to upload his CV or career graph along with co-curricular activities etc. either by following a sample CV available on the website of this Institute or a student can make his own. After having done this and after having paid the registration fee this Institute conducts written test for each and every student on the Sunday after the close of registration date. This examination is called MUBAAT. The institution's admission committee then goes through the response of the students to this test and also the CV which they have uploaded at the time of registration and then shortlists the students. These students are then called for the next round in which they conduct interview, group discussion, essay writing including video essays and then analysis of essays etc. based on this the institute makes a probable list of 60 candidates and then they are offered admission which a student has to take by paying the requisite fees. Some candidates are kept in the reserve but there is no merit list. If any student from the main list does not take admission for any reason then a student who is equivalent to this drop out is called up and offered the seat for admission. This is how the complete admission process is completed and then the 16 months of the course begins.
